I came here with a general knowledge of what I could and could not eat. I mean, even if I forget if the spinach dip has chicken stock, I know I can always have the flatbread and a black bean burger as a vegetarian. Last night The bartender was SO nice and brought out their new allergen menu. This menu is coded with little symbols for shellfish, milk, wheat, eggs and other things that people may not eat or be allergic to. Funny enough, everything on the menu had the shellfish symbol next to it except for one thing: The flatbread. How is this possible a black bean burger has shellfish in it? This unnerved me slightly, until the manager came out with the black bean burger ingredients and assured me that there was no shellfish in there at all. In fact, they were Morningstar farms products. The manager didn’t have to come out and talk to me at all, so I feel that was excellent customer service. They have wifi now at this location.
